// /***************************************************************************
// Aaru Data Preservation Suite
// ----------------------------------------------------------------------------
//
// Filename : Context.cs
// Author(s) : Natalia Portillo <claunia@claunia.com>
//
// Component : Aaru Server.
//
// --[ Description ] ----------------------------------------------------------
//
// Entity framework database context.

using System.Data.Common;
using Aaru.CommonTypes.Metadata;
using Aaru.Server.Database.Models;
using Microsoft.AspNetCore.Identity;
using Microsoft.AspNetCore.Identity.EntityFrameworkCore;
using Microsoft.EntityFrameworkCore;
using Microsoft.Extensions.Configuration;
using OperatingSystem = Aaru.Server.Database.Models.OperatingSystem;
using Version = Aaru.Server.Database.Models.Version;
namespace Aaru.Server.Database;
public sealed class DbContext : IdentityDbContext<IdentityUser>
{
public DbContext() {}
public DbContext(DbContextOptions<DbContext> options) : base(options) {}
public DbSet<Device> Devices { get; set; }
public DbSet<UploadedReport> Reports { get; set; }
public DbSet<Command> Commands { get; set; }
public DbSet<DeviceStat> DeviceStats { get; set; }
public DbSet<Filesystem> Filesystems { get; set; }
public DbSet<Filter> Filters { get; set; }
public DbSet<Media> Medias { get; set; }
public DbSet<MediaFormat> MediaFormats { get; set; }
public DbSet<OperatingSystem> OperatingSystems { get; set; }
public DbSet<Partition> Partitions { get; set; }
public DbSet<Version> Versions { get; set; }
public DbSet<UsbVendor> UsbVendors { get; set; }
public DbSet<UsbProduct> UsbProducts { get; set; }
public DbSet<CompactDiscOffset> CdOffsets { get; set; }
public DbSet<Ata> Ata { get; set; }
public DbSet<BlockDescriptor> BlockDescriptor { get; set; }
public DbSet<Chs> Chs { get; set; }
public DbSet<FireWire> FireWire { get; set; }
public DbSet<Mmc> Mmc { get; set; }
public DbSet<MmcSd> MmcSd { get; set; }
public DbSet<MmcFeatures> MmcFeatures { get; set; }
public DbSet<Pcmcia> Pcmcia { get; set; }
public DbSet<Scsi> Scsi { get; set; }
public DbSet<ScsiMode> ScsiMode { get; set; }
public DbSet<ScsiPage> ScsiPage { get; set; }
public DbSet<Ssc> Ssc { get; set; }
public DbSet<SupportedDensity> SupportedDensity { get; set; }
public DbSet<TestedMedia> TestedMedia { get; set; }
public DbSet<TestedSequentialMedia> TestedSequentialMedia { get; set; }
public DbSet<Usb> Usb { get; set; }
public DbSet<RemoteApplication> RemoteApplications { get; set; }
public DbSet<RemoteArchitecture> RemoteArchitectures { get; set; }
public DbSet<RemoteOperatingSystem> RemoteOperatingSystems { get; set; }
public DbSet<GdRomSwapDiscCapabilities> GdRomSwapDiscCapabilities { get; set; }
public DbSet<NesHeaderInfo> NesHeaders { get; set; }
protected override void OnConfiguring(DbContextOptionsBuilder optionsBuilder)
{
if(optionsBuilder.IsConfigured) return;
IConfigurationBuilder builder = new ConfigurationBuilder().AddJsonFile("appsettings.json");
IConfigurationRoot configuration = builder.Build();
optionsBuilder
.UseMySql(configuration.GetConnectionString("DefaultConnection"),
new MariaDbServerVersion(new System.Version(10, 4, 0)))
.UseLazyLoadingProxies();
}

internal static bool TableExists(string tableName)
{
using var db = new DbContext();
DbConnection connection = db.Database.GetDbConnection();
connection.Open();
DbCommand command = connection.CreateCommand();
command.CommandText =
$"SELECT COUNT(*) FROM INFORMATION_SCHEMA.TABLES WHERE TABLE_SCHEMA=DATABASE() AND TABLE_NAME=\"{tableName}\"";
var result = (long)command.ExecuteScalar();
return result != 0;
}
}
